Have a small key on the secondary key-ring, looks like it should be for the outside TV door lock, like on the main key-ring. It however does not unlock the TV door, and is labeled R0001. Any idea what this is for? I've verified with 2 other XL owners, and they both have this same mysterious key, same number on it too.



Jim
 
The infamous R001 key locks the lower outside storage doors. All RV’s made I think use the same R001. You can buy them on Amazon.
 
Interesting, Milkman. I just ran out and checked the key on our lower storage doors and it doesn't work on our XL. We have the chrome, and possibly newer style bay door latches though. Assuming they are just accidentally getting sent with new XLs even though they don't work on anything.

Our 28ss keyring included a set of 751 keys - standard RV keys we have had on previous trailers. We have never found anything on the 28ss it will unlock. R001s on the storage bays, 507CH on the rear hatch, etc.

We kept tubing our toes on the thumb latch on the hatch under the bed that accesses the water filter, often opening the hatch. So I replaced the thumb latch with a 751 tumbler I had from a prior trailer. Now the 751 keys have a purpose and we don't stub toes any more (well, not on that item).
